Quantity Recommendations
Orders Under 5 Tons - Add 20% extra to your estimated gravel needs.
5+ Ton Orders - Add around 10% to ensure enough additional material on hand.

Which materials work best for Longmont projects that face freeze–thaw cycles and snow?
Choose materials known for good drainage and stability in cold climates, and ask suppliers how local geology affects performance. Proper base preparation, compaction, and drainage details are as important as material choice to resist freeze–thaw damage. When is the best time of year to schedule delivery and installation in Longmont?
Late spring through early fall is often best for landscape deliveries and installations because ground is easier to work and drying times are quicker. Winter deliveries are possible but may be slower or restricted by weather and frozen ground; plan extra lead time for snow or freeze-thaw conditions. How do Longmont's snowfall and drainage patterns affect material choice and installation methods?
Areas with heavier snowfall or poor drainage need materials and installation that resist erosion and allow water to move away from structures. Prioritize well-draining aggregates, proper slope away from foundations, and the use of edging or drainage channels as needed. How do homeowners in Longmont calculate quantities and choose order sizes for bulk materials?
Most people calculate material by measuring the area and depth required, then converting to tons or cubic yards using our online calculator or guidance. Remember our minimum order is 3 tons, so round up to cover compaction and waste. If unsure, send measurements or photos and our team can help estimate how much gravel, sand, dirt, or stone you need.

How do costs and upkeep compare between common materials for Longmont landscaping and erosion control?
Lower-cost materials often require more frequent topping up and maintenance, while higher-cost, well-graded materials can last longer and reduce routine upkeep. Consider lifecycle costs: initial material and installation plus expected regrading, replacement, and winter maintenance.
